Strawberry Chia Seeds Pudding

Enjoyed as a wholesome breakfast, a satisfying snack, or a convenient meal prep option, this recipe is a healthy chia pudding is one that you can indulge in at any time of the day.

Prep Time: 10 minutes
Total Time: 10 minutes
Servings: 3 servings
Calories: 141kcal

Ingredients

  • cup strawberries ripe
  • 3 tablespoons chia seeds
  • 2 cups almond milk or any preferred dairy-free milk - I like coconut milk for a thicker mixture.
  • 1-2 tablespoons maple syrup adjust to taste
  • ½ te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 pinch salt
  • raw honey optional as a topping

Instructions

Make Chia Seed Pudding:

  • In a bowl, combine chia seeds, almond milk, maple syrup, pinch of salt, and vanilla extract. Stir the mixture thoroughly to ensure that the chia seeds are well combined.
    3 tablespoons chia seeds, 2 cups almond milk, 1-2 tablespoons maple syrup, ½ teaspoon vanilla extract, 1 pinch salt
  • Place the chia seed mix in the refrigerator for at least 4 hours, but preferably overnight, to allow the chia seeds to expand and create a pudding-like consistency.

Prepare the Strawberries:

  • Wash and remove the stems from the strawberries. Chop them into small pieces. Blend some of them for a smoother texture and a layered effect. This is optional.
    1½ cup strawberries

Serve and Enjoy:

  • Once the pudding has reached the desired consistency, give it a good stir and portion it into serving dishes. Layer with blended strawberry, and top it with the sliced strawberries.
  • Add a drizzle of raw honey if you would like extra sweetness.
    raw honey
